There's a lot of great choices for armor materials out there that will give it a nice rigid appearance. Vaccuumformed plastic (like stormtrooper armor), worbla, leather, EVA foam. Depending on what you feel comfortable with in terms of weight, if you're making it yourself, etc. I know there are places that make it to standards with some minor adjustments, but I'm not sure of the names haha.

I'm building mine using pvc sheets of 3mm and overlaping the layers of the to same shape of the revan Armor.

 

The I'm using 4 layers to build my armor. As I can take a few pictures I can post here.
